How to apply for PAN 2.0 online and and receive new PAN card on your email ID
The Income Tax Department's PAN 2.0 offers digital e-PAN cards with a QR code for enhanced security, free for up to three requests. Physical PAN cards cost Rs. 50 domestically and Rs. 15 plus postal charges internationally. Existing PAN cards remain valid, and updates to PAN details are free under this new initiative.

Champions Trophy: Suspense continues as ICC Board meet deferred
The ICC Board's virtual meeting did not lead to a decision on the Champions Trophy 2025. The BCCI has declined to travel to Pakistan and prefers a hybrid model with games in UAE. The PCB remains firm on hosting the entire event in Pakistan, causing a delay in fixture announcements and broadcaster clarity.

Bangladesh freezes bank accounts of 17 people linked to Iskcon, including Das'
Bangladesh's financial authorities have ordered banks to freeze the accounts of 17 individuals linked to Iskcon, including former spokesperson Chinmoy Krishna Das, for 30 days. This follows Das's arrest related to a sedition case involving a rally in Chattogram where a saffron flag was allegedly hoisted above the national flag, sparking widespread outrage and demands for his release.

India, Russia exploring joint production of Sukhoi engine
India and Russia are considering joint production of AL-31FP engines for the Su-30MKI fighters, following discussions during DK Sunil's visit to Russia. This follows HAL's recent contract to deliver 240 engines, vital for the Indian Air Force.
